Key Takeaways
- β
Blockchain Developers in Germany earn 7% more than in Sweden (nominal USD).
- β
After adjusting for purchasing power (PPP), Germany actually leads by 22%.
- β
Using the Big Mac Index, a Blockchain Developer's salary buys 1.1x more Big Macs in Germany.

Frequently Asked Questions
Who pays Blockchain Developers more: Sweden or Germany?βΎ
Germany pays Blockchain Developers an estimated $82,529 USD per year, which is 7% more than Sweden's estimated $77,320 USD.
What is the PPP-adjusted salary for a Blockchain Developer in Sweden vs Germany?βΎ
The PPP-adjusted salary is $97,406 USD in Sweden and $119,262 USD in Germany. PPP adjustment accounts for cost of living differences between the two countries.
How does the purchasing power compare for Blockchain Developers?βΎ
Using the Big Mac Index, a Blockchain Developer in Sweden can buy about 13,105 Big Macs per year, while in Germany it's about 14,353 Big Macs.
